Global Electronics Packaging: Regulatory Dynamics & Engineering Demands

Unlocking supply chain velocity requires deep expertise in electrostatic discharge (ESD) mitigation, CE certification, and cross-border structural compliance.

The international electronics sector requires strict compliance and mechanical integrity. As semiconductor nodes shrink and printed circuit board assemblies (PCBAs) grow more complex, electronic components are increasingly vulnerable to electrostatic discharge (ESD), mechanical stress, atmospheric humidity, and chemical contaminants. Packaging is no longer just a container; it is a critical defensive system designed to maintain product integrity from the cleanroom of the manufacturer to the end-user.

For European and global markets, CE Certification in electronic packaging indicates conformity with critical health, safety, and environmental protection directives. Crucially, this requires compliance with the European Packaging and Packaging Waste Directive (94/62/EC), as well as substance restriction policies under RoHS (2011/65/EU) and REACH (EC 1907/2006). Global procurement teams must partner with exporters capable of proving chemical, structural, and anti-static compliance through testing certifications.

At the same time, the industry is undergoing a structural shift toward sustainable manufacturing. The trade-offs between static dissipation, mechanical shock buffering, and environmental degradation require high-performance material engineering. Innovations in mono-material corrugated shipping boxes, biodegradable frosted poly mailers, and plant-based cushion moldings are replacing traditional single-use petrochemical plastics. This helps global brands reduce their overall carbon footprint and meet strict Extended Producer Responsibility (EPR) requirements in the EU.

Localization Support, Certification & Compliance Standards

Navigating regional testing standards to ensure frictionless customs clearance and supply chain security.

EU Directives & EN Standards

Ensures complete compliance with 94/62/EC for heavy metal reduction (lead, cadmium, mercury, and hexavalent chromium content < 100 ppm) alongside EN 13427 certifications for overall packaging waste recovery.

ESD Safekeeping & EN 61340

Designated packaging for electronic systems integrates electrostatic shielding, conductive polymers, and dissipative layers tested to EN 61340-5-1 standards, preventing static discharge damage.

CONEG & FDA Compliance

Compliant with US CONEG model packaging legislation limiting heavy metals, alongside FSC-certified wood pulp products and FDA-compliant coatings for cleanroom-packaged instruments.

Regulatory Compliance Verification Matrix

Regulatory Standard Target Region Compliance Goal / Parameter Verification Method
Directive 94/62/EC European Union Packaging waste volume mitigation, heavy metal < 100ppm ICP-OES Spectrometry Testing
EN 61340-5-1 Global / Europe Electrostatic protection for ESD-sensitive devices Surface Resistivity Testing (105 - 1011 Ω)
RoHS 2011/65/EU European Union Restricts 10 hazardous chemicals in electronic accessories XRF Screening & GC-MS Analysis
FSC Certified Global Market Traceable, ethically sourced sustainable forest fibers FSC Chain-of-Custody (CoC) Auditing
ISTA 3A / 6-Amazon North America / EU Transit vibration, compression, and impact durability Drop Tower & Vibration Table Simulation

Global Industry Trends (2025-2030)

Key developments shaping the future of global logistics and high-tech electronic packaging.

Smart and Interactive Packaging

Smart packaging is becoming standard for high-value logistics. By integrating RFID tags, NFC antennas, and temperature sensors into rigid box structures, manufacturers can track shipments in real-time, monitor environmental conditions, and confirm product authenticity.

These integrated components allow logistics systems to flag issues like physical shocks or temperature fluctuations instantly, helping protect sensitive shipments before they reach their final destination.

Transition to Mono-Material Designs

Traditional packaging often bonds plastics, papers, and foils together, making recycling difficult. The industry is moving toward mono-material designs, which use a single type of polymer or fiber for both the outer box and the inner tray. This simplifies the recycling process and makes it easier for consumers to dispose of packaging responsibly.

Technical Q&A / Frequently Asked Questions

Answers to common technical, compliance, and logistical questions from international buyers.

Q: How do you verify compliance with the EU Packaging Waste Directive (94/62/EC)?
A: We test our raw materials using ICP-OES spectrometry to ensure that the combined concentration of lead, cadmium, mercury, and hexavalent chromium is under 100 ppm. We provide complete chemical testing reports with each production batch to simplify customs clearance in European ports.
Q: What surface resistivity levels do your ESD protective bags and trays provide?
A: Our electrostatic dissipative packaging is engineered to maintain a surface resistivity of 106 to 1010 ohms, complying with EN 61340-5-1 standards. This ensures safe static dissipation without sudden discharges that could damage sensitive circuit boards.
Q: Can you customize packaging dimensions and internal structures for heavy server components?
A: Yes. Our structural engineering team designs heavy-duty packaging using high-test double-wall or triple-wall corrugated board and density-mapped foam inserts. We test our structures using drop and vibration simulations to ensure they protect heavy equipment during transit.
